Dyno Numbers.....JB3 2.0,DPs, FMIC, ....etc

Along with Dfries, Nick.CBR and Ajvee, It was my first trip to the dyno with this car. ( I know, should've gotten a baseline...I just couldn't help myself from buying parts before I even had the car)

Anyways, here are my stats.

E90 335i
JB3 2.0, MAP 3 only
VK Downpipes, Ceramic coated and wrapped
AMS Intercooler
CP-E Charge Pipe/Tial BOV
Top Speed Exhaust
93 Octane
Elevation: 1100 ft, 50 degrees, ???humidity
Dynojet Dyno

Another thing to note...I've got Forgestar F14s (18lbs each)...I would think this has to make SOME difference???

379 HP
392 TQ


I was intending on running MAP 7, but long story short I had my pedal mapping disabled and my laptop crashed the night before...of course.

For map 3, I'm very happy with these numbers! I'd say any daily driver with 350+hp is amazing.

Not quite sure what to think. For some reason I don't think 379 is wayyyy above expected...considering the mods and odd variances that exist from car to car. For example, two IDENTICAL cars (identical tune, identical software, identical intake) had a difference of 30whp. Some cars simply make more power for no apparant reason.

In addition, I only peaked 14.6 PSI...normally map 7 brings me up to 16.2+ (and that's in Feb/March). I'm not trying to defend anything here...it does seem high for map 3. I don't know what else to think though.
